Introduction to Healthcare Systems Management

In the ever-evolving landscape of healthcare, healthcare systems management plays a crucial role in streamlining operations, improving patient care, and enhancing overall efficiency. It encompasses the coordinated approach to managing health resources, including personnel, technologies, and information systems, to ensure that healthcare organizations function effectively. By integrating various processes, healthcare systems management drives advancements in treatment quality and accessibility while balancing costs and resources.

Types of Healthcare Systems Management

The field of healthcare systems management is diverse, touching various aspects of healthcare operations. Below are some notable types of management systems:

  • Clinical Management Systems: Focused on patient care operations, clinical management systems help healthcare providers oversee patient records, treatment protocols, and clinical workflows.
  • Financial Management Systems: These systems are designed to manage billing, budgeting, and financial reporting, ensuring that healthcare organizations remain economically viable.
  • Human Resource Management Systems: They deal with the administration of personnel, including recruitment, training, performance reviews, and retention strategies.
  • Information Technology Systems: This type integrates advanced technology solutions to enhance data storage, retrieval, and cybersecurity within healthcare environments.

Function and Feature of Healthcare Systems Management

The functionality of healthcare systems management revolves around several salient features that enhance operational tasks. Key functions and features include:

  • Data Integration: Unifying diverse data sources allows for real-time access to patient information, supporting informed decision-making.
  • Workflow Automation: Automating routine tasks leads to improved consistency and reduces human error, ultimately streamlining processes.
  • Compliance Monitoring: Systems ensure adherence to healthcare regulations and standards, minimizing legal risks while enhancing safety.
  • Performance Analytics: Offering insights into operational performance, these systems help identify areas for improvement and facilitate strategic planning.

Applications of Healthcare Systems Management

The applications of healthcare systems management extend across various settings, proving essential for different healthcare providers. These applications include:

  • Hospital Administration: It is pivotal in managing the multifaceted operations of hospitals, from nursing staff schedules to patient admissions.
  • Outpatient Services: Streamlining processes in outpatient clinics to improve patient experience and increase appointment scheduling efficiency.
  • Public Health Monitoring: Assists governmental and non-governmental organizations in tracking public health metrics, ensuring resources are allocated appropriately.
  • Pharmaceutical Management: Facilitates the oversight and distribution of medications, ensuring compliance with safety regulations.

Advantages of Implementing Healthcare Systems Management

Investing in efficient healthcare systems management yields numerous benefits that can transform healthcare delivery. Key advantages include:

  • Enhanced Patient Care: Improved data management and integration lead to better patient outcomes, reduced wait times, and increased satisfaction.
  • Cost Savings: Streamlined operations can significantly cut unnecessary expenses and optimize resource allocation across the board.
  • Increased Productivity: Systems that automate routine tasks allow healthcare staff to focus on more complex patient care challenges.
  • Improved Regulatory Compliance: Staying compliant becomes more manageable with integrated systems, reducing the risk of penalties and enhancing trust.
